Informing this to media here on Tuesday, College Principal Dr M Prem D’Souza said nearly 20 colleges from across the country would take part in the fest and each team would comprise a total of 12 students.
The underlying theme of the three-day event is ‘Anveshana’ - discovery of the self - which is aimed at drawing students of every faculty to come together, to seek, to strive and to learn by participating in creative activities, she said.
Union Minister for Labour and Employment Oscar Fernandes will inaugurate the fest. Home Guards District Commandant Dr Shivaprasad Rai will the chief guests, while Principal Dr Prem D’Souza will preside.
In the valedictory to be held at 3.30 pm on October 6, Yenepoya Group of Companies Director Farhaad Yenepoya and Ms Surumi Yenepoya will take part.
The event include competitions like upahasvana (best comedy show), alankara (window dressing), vishwa sanskriti (variety entertainment), athiranjana (mad ad), adhivijjana (quiz), avatatana (movie spoof), adhikarana (mock court), abhinaya (street play), noopura (contemporary dance), patrika (newsletter) and sadhri (best personality).
